Output 7593d68b50786cc2a87e321cc4683e52e43888efd8cdc61e5575c221d9bf3d5b:111

value
450872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ce0f59e05fa4ee39f488245528e507a60312106b OP_EQUAL
address
DPve8PQvNvy1GpJ8Ns182DbXaPvny92yxS
transaction
7593d68b50786cc2a87e321cc4683e52e43888efd8cdc61e5575c221d9bf3d5b
spent
true